There are Florida luxury golf resorts, and then there is Streamsong Resort, which steers refreshingly clear of many common Florida golf resort conventions. The 216-room property is inland, and two hours from both Orlando’s and Tampa’s airports by car. It covers 16,000 acres of dunes, prairies and forests that, at different angles, evoke African savannah, the Australian outback and terrain from other corners of the United States. A day rolling along its Black, Blue or Red courses can resemble a safari with a surprising array of wildlife. Three main buildings — The Lodge, the Red Blue Clubhouse and the Black Clubhouse — carve a dramatic presence in this unusual, otherworldly setting.

 

It is also unquestionably golf-centric, which makes it a wonderfully tranquil place for serious enthusiasts to try out its three challenging courses, designed by pros Tom Doak, Bill Coore, Ben Crenshaw and Gil Hanse and have quality permutations of father-and-son or guy’s weekend (or girl’s weekend) family time. Along with these one-of-a-kind courses, there are other activities providing visitors with a genuine appreciation of this hidden corner of Florida.

Before or after a round of golf, guests can try their hand at archery, sporting clay shooting, trick golf shots on floating platforms or bass fishing with the resort’s affable guides. While these activities will also make non-golfing guests feel welcome, golf lessons taught by the resort’s pros and its Gauntlet 18-hole putting green allows everybody to participate in its decidedly un-snobby take on the golfer’s lifestyle. There is also a nature walk around the lodge any guest can enjoy (weather permitting) as well as a beautiful infinity pool. However, management suggests more activities will be rolled out over the next year that will be in tune with its natural setting.

The AcquaPietra Spa, which offers an extensive selection of massages, facials and treatments with Naturopathica products, also takes a fresh approach to the resort experience. Rather than affecting a Southeast Asian or European setting, it exists on its own terms in a way that’s harmonious with its singular outdoor landscape. While most resorts allow guests to use spa amenities on the day of their treatments, here they are welcome to use the four thermal pools, cold plunge pool and saunas throughout their stay.

With the exception of SottoTerra, its excellent Italian fine-dining venue, Streamsong’s restaurants all constitute an inventive mix of Southern, New American and Tex-Mex sensibilities while maintaining distinctive identities. Restaurant Fifty-Nine is a USDA Prime steakhouse in the Streamsong Red-Blue clubhouse with elegant and seasonal preparations of beef and seafood mostly harvested off the Florida coast. Bone Valley Tavern, the gastropub in the recently completed Streamsong Black Clubhouse, is focused on inventive variations on classics such as nachos, salads and sandwiches by day and elegantly, casual-plated dishes by night.

P2O5 (a nod to the area’s phosphate mining industry), a contemporary three-meal restaurant in the main lodge, also features a fine weekend breakfast buffet. Rooftop cocktail bar Fragmentary Blue is the perfect happy hour hangout with its novel nibbles, generous artisanal cocktails and the night’s PGA, NFL, NBA or Major League Baseball games projected on large screens. Some of the most memorable holes in one, food wise, are the grab-and-go items such as brisket and tacos served at different snack shacks between the eighth and ninth greens of Black, Blue and Red courses.

 

Although the resort does not actively court families with young children, we observed a few sets of golf-loving parents traveling with their children enjoying it to the fullest. Those kids clearly got a kick out of being watched by the resident raccoon and other critters through Bone Valley Tavern’s panoramic windows. As several rooms, restaurants and outdoor spaces are available for weddings and other family celebrations, the staff will accommodate children and teens traveling with their parents (especially budding golf fans).
